Top 12 Family-Friendly Cruise Lines
Family cruises offer a fantastic vacation solution, combining convenience and fun for all ages. Families benefit from bundled accommodations, meals, and endless activities, all without the hassles of cooking or transport logistics. The best cruise ships provide exceptional facilities that keep children entertained, giving parents well-deserved time to relax.
Many cruise lines also feature the option to explore multiple destinations without the need for cumbersome logistics like car rentals or public transport. However, it’s essential to review each ship’s specific amenities and inclusions before making a reservation. Here are 12 of the top cruise lines that cater excellently to families.
1. Marella Cruises
Marella Cruises, under Tui’s umbrella, provides an all-inclusive family voyage without the usual stresses. The basic fare covers everything from transfers to select alcoholic beverages and mocktails. Families can choose from various restaurants offering kid-friendly meals. Kids’ clubs cater to ages 3 to 11 with activities like pirate hunts and mini-discos, while teenagers have dedicated areas. Moreover, children receive a plush toy and activity booklet to keep them engaged during the trip.
2. Explora Journeys
Explora Journeys provides a luxury experience akin to a five-star hotel on water, welcoming families with children aged six months and older (infants below two sail for free). The cruise line features interconnecting suites for space, engaging kids’ activities, and a poolside gelateria. The Nautilus Club room has games consoles and recreational amenities. The standard fare includes meals, drinks, room service, and gratuities, alongside complimentary wi-fi for teens.
3. Celebrity Cruises
Celebrity Cruises ensures that entertainment options are available for toddlers up to teens through its Camp at Sea program, which includes slumber parties and Xbox stations. Educational opportunities focus on marine conservation and STEM subjects, with complimentary kids’ clubs available in most cases. Cruises typically include meals (excluding specialty dining), shows, and activities, with additional options like drinks and wi-fi available through the All Included package.
4. MSC Cruises
MSC Cruises entertain families throughout the day with award-winning amenities. Activities range from ziplines and bowling alleys to Broadway-inspired performances. The MSC Virtuosa features a special tech zone for teens, a silent disco, and a water park. Full-board meals, various entertainment options, and numerous activities are included, while excursions and select drinks are an additional cost.
5. Norwegian Cruise Line
Norwegian Cruise Line stands out for its flexible dining options, eliminating set meal times. Each ship offers various kids’ activities, with Norwegian Encore boasting exciting features like a Speedway race track and virtual reality experiences. The cruise fare includes meals, activities, and entertainment, though drinks and popular extras may cost extra. Occasional promotions allow kids to sail free, offering great savings.
6. P&O Cruises
P&O Cruises has launched their Excel class ship, Arvia, featuring activities like high-ropes courses and mini-golf, alongside entertainment options like a cinema. Most family activities, including kids’ clubs and meals, are part of the cruise package (excluding specialty dining), attracting a primarily British clientele.
7. Princess Cruises
Princess Cruises has innovated with the MedallionClass system, allowing parents to locate their children easily while enjoying onboard meals and activities. Standout features include an indoor planetarium, stargazing opportunities, and family splash zones. The package includes onboard activities, kids’ clubs, and main dining (with most drinks at an added cost).
8. Royal Caribbean
Royal Caribbean ships feature thrilling activities like rock climbing, ice skating, and zip lining. The Anthem of the Seas offers unique experiences such as skydiving simulators, surf simulators, and bumper cars. Complete package itineraries include full board meals and many entertainment options, though specialty dining and other extras carry an additional charge.
9. Uniworld
Uniworld is recognized for its luxury offerings, providing family-friendly river cruise experiences through its Generations program. This program includes engaging activities on land, such as paddleboarding and treasure hunts, along with onboard perks like PlayStation lounges and crafting workshops. The all-inclusive packages cover activities, bike rentals, and premium drinks, often including flights.
10. A-Rosa
A-Rosa prioritizes family experiences with spacious cabins and family-friendly activities. The E-Motion offerings feature toy boxes and children’s amenities, allowing adult guests to visit the spa while kids engage in various entertaining activities. Included are meals and selected drinks, with free kids’ clubs offered during school holidays.
11. Carnival
Carnival offers unique attractions for families, like the first rollercoaster at sea, named Bolt, along with craft studios and aerial bike experiences. The Mardi Gras ship is particularly captivating, equipped with waterslides and mini-golf. Families can take advantage of spacious staterooms and a lounge, with the cruise covering meals (except specialty dining), entertainment, and kids’ programs.
12. Disney Cruise Line
Disney Cruise Line encapsulates the charm of its theme parks, allowing kids to attend beauty salons, meet beloved characters, and enjoy shows based on classic Disney stories. A highlight is cruising to Castaway Cay, Disney’s private island featuring a snorkeling lagoon and teen hangouts. Packages encompass entertainment, dining (including room service), and youth clubs but charge extra for alcoholic drinks and dining upgrades.
FAQs
Which cruise lines have family suites?
Family suites are available on various cruise lines, including Royal Caribbean, which offers fun perks like slides and cinemas, as well as Celebrity Cruises, Carnival, Princess, MSC, Disney, and Norwegian Cruise Line, with its Haven Family Villas on select ships.
How much do family cruises cost on average?
Average costs vary based on cabin selection and destination, but families of four can expect to spend from £1,500 for a seven-night Mediterranean trip. Kids Sail Free promotions can lead to significant savings.
What’s the cheapest month to go on a cruise?
The bargain season is influenced by the itinerary and location, with Caribbean cruises often cheaper during terms or hurricane seasons. For Mediterranean cruises, consider going in March, April, or November when demand drops.
